Madison West Statistics Back to top
- Population (2000): 2,406
- Land Area (2000): 110.485 square kilometers
- Water Area (2000): 0.499 square kilometers
Houses (2000): 958
Madison West Population - Urban/Rural
Urban/Rural | Population | Percent |
---|---|---|
Urban | 0 | 0.00% |
Rural, Farm | 240 | 10.18% |
Rural, Non-farm | 2,118 | 89.82% |
